HAVANA TIMES, Dec 30 — Cuban owners of insured cars have expressed dissatisfaction with the low levels of indemnities, delays in the delivery of replacement cars and the policy of denying the replacement of stolen cars.
In a letter sent to the Granma newspaper, the director of the national insurance company (Seguros Nacionales) made public the complaints of its users and challenges of its business.
“There have been delays caused by not having the number of vehicles available in the country for these purposes within the required time,” explained the executive.
However, he added that the company guarantees its customers that it will meet all of its commitments and that they are working to shorten delivery times.
